Cemetery Of Hajjiabad
Cemetery Of Hajjiabad is a cemetery in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ran. Cemetery Of Hajjiabad is situated nearby to Imamzadeh Seyyed Habib Garden, as well as near Ostad Hassan Garden.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hajjiabad is a village in Zeberkhan Rural District, Central District, Zeberkhan County,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2016 census, its population was 1,637, in 509 families.

Kariz-e Now is a village in Zeberkhan Rural District, Zeberkhan District, Nishapur County,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 599, in 163 families.

Qarah Dash is a village in Zeberkhan Rural District, Zeberkhan District, Nishapur County,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 282, in 70 families.
